1 |
1
우선 콘텐츠 데이터의 서비스 품질(QoS)을 기준 수준 이상으로 보장할 수 있도록 상기 우선 콘텐츠 데이터를 위하여 할당될 가상 슬롯의 길이와 주기를 결정하는 단계; 상기 결정된 길이와 주기를 포함하는, 상기 가상 슬롯에 대한 할당요청 메시지를 네트워크 상에 브로드캐스팅하는 단계; 및상기 결정된 길이와 주기에 따라 상기 우선 콘텐츠 데이터를 상기 가상 슬롯을 이용하여 전송하는 단계;를 포함하는 실시간성 우선 콘텐츠 데이터 전송 방법
|
2 |
2
제1항에 있어서,상기 우선 콘텐츠 데이터를 상기 가상 슬롯을 이용하여 전송하는 단계는상기 네트워크 상에 타 단말로부터 데이터가 전송되고 있는지 확인하는 단계; 및상기 확인 결과에 기초하여 상기 가상 슬롯의 시작 시간을 데이터 전송 지연변이의 허용 범위 내에서 조정하는 단계;를 포함하는 실시간성 우선 콘텐츠 데이터 전송 방법
|
3 |
3
제1항에 있어서,상기 우선 콘텐츠 데이터를 상기 가상 슬롯을 이용하여 전송하는 단계는이전에 할당된 가상 슬롯으로부터 상기 결정된 주기만큼의 시간이 경과한 후 상기 네트워크 상에 타 단말로부터 데이터가 전송되고 있는지 확인하는 단계; 및상기 확인 결과 상기 네트워크 상에 타 단말로부터 데이터가 전송되고 있으면, 상기 가상 슬롯의 시작 시간을 데이터 전송 지연변이의 허용 범위 내에서 조정하는 단계;를 포함하는 실시간성 우선 콘텐츠 데이터 전송 방법
|
4 |
4
제1항에 있어서,상기 우선 콘텐츠 데이터에 대한 코덱 정보 및 상기 우선 콘텐츠 데이터의 서비스 품질(QoS)에 대한 상기 기준 수준을 고려하여 상기 우선 콘텐츠 데이터에 대한 데이터 전송 지연변이의 허용 범위를 결정하는 단계;를 더 포함하는 실시간성 우선 콘텐츠 데이터 전송 방법
|
5 |
5
제1항에 있어서,상기 가상 슬롯을 이용한 상기 우선 콘텐츠 데이터에 해당하는 모든 데이터의 전송이 완료되면, 상기 가상 슬롯에 대한 해제 메시지를 브로드캐스팅하는 단계;를 더 포함하는 실시간성 우선 콘텐츠 데이터 전송 방법
|
6 |
6
우선 콘텐츠 데이터를 전송하지 않는 단말에서, 상기 우선 콘텐츠 데이터의 서비스 품질(QoS)을 기준 수준 이상으로 보장할 수 있도록 상기 우선 콘텐츠 데이터를 위하여 할당될 가상 슬롯에 대하여 결정된 길이와 주기 정보를 포함하는, 상기 가상 슬롯에 대한 할당요청 메시지를 네트워크로부터 수신하는 단계; 및상기 우선 콘텐츠 데이터를 전송하지 않는 단말에서, 상기 가상 슬롯에 대한 길이와 주기 정보에 기초하여 도출되는, 상기 가상 슬롯에 대하여 할당된 시간 구간 이외의 시간 구간에 상기 네트워크 상에 상기 우선 콘텐츠 데이터를 전송하지 않는 단말 자신의 전송 슬롯에서 보낼 데이터를 전송하는 단계;를 포함하는 실시간성 우선 콘텐츠 데이터의 품질 보장 방법
|
7 |
7
제6항에 있어서,상기 우선 콘텐츠 데이터를 전송하지 않는 단말에서, 상기 가상 슬롯에 대한 할당요청 메시지로부터 상기 우선 콘텐츠 데이터에 대한 데이터 전송 지연변이의 허용 범위 정보를 추출하는 단계;를 더 포함하고,상기 네트워크 상에 상기 우선 콘텐츠 데이터를 전송하지 않는 단말 자신의 전송 슬롯에서 보낼 데이터를 전송하는 단계는,상기 단말 자신의 전송 슬롯에서 보낼 데이터의 전송이 종료되는 시간이 상기 가상 슬롯에 대하여 할당된 시작 시간으로부터 상기 데이터 전송 지연변이의 허용 범위 이내인지 판단하는 단계; 및상기 단말 자신의 전송 슬롯에서 보낼 데이터의 전송이 종료되는 시간이 상기 가상 슬롯에 대하여 할당된 시작 시간으로부터 상기 데이터 전송 지연변이의 허용 범위 이내이면 상기 단말 자신의 전송 슬롯에서 보낼 데이터를 상기 네트워크 상에 전송하는 단계;를 포함하는 실시간성 우선 콘텐츠 데이터의 품질 보장 방법
|
8 |
8
제6항에 있어서,상기 우선 콘텐츠 데이터를 전송하지 않는 단말에서, 상기 가상 슬롯에 대한 할당요청 메시지에 대한 수신확인 메시지를 상기 네트워크 상에 전송하는 단계;를 더 포함하는 실시간성 우선 콘텐츠 데이터의 품질 보장 방법
|
9 |
9
제1항 내지 제8항 중 어느 한 항의 방법을 실행하기 위한 프로그램이 기록되어 있는 것을 특징으로 하는 컴퓨터에서 판독 가능한 기록 매체
|
10 |
10
우선 콘텐츠 데이터의 서비스 품질(QoS)을 기준 수준 이상으로 보장할 수 있도록 상기 우선 콘텐츠 데이터를 위하여 할당될 가상 슬롯의 길이와 주기를 결정하는 가상 슬롯 정보 결정부;상기 결정된 길이와 주기를 포함하는, 상기 가상 슬롯에 대한 할당요청 메시지를 네트워크 상에 브로드캐스팅하는 메시지 전송부; 및상기 결정된 길이와 주기에 따라 상기 우선 콘텐츠 데이터를 상기 가상 슬롯을 이용하여 전송하는 데이터 전송부;를 포함하는 실시간성 우선 콘텐츠 데이터 전송 장치
|
11 |
11
제10항에 있어서,상기 데이터 전송부는상기 네트워크 상에 타 단말로부터 데이터가 전송되고 있는지 확인하는 모니터링부; 및상기 모니터링부의 확인 결과에 기초하여 상기 가상 슬롯의 시작 시간을 데이터 전송 지연변이의 허용 범위 내에서 조정하는 시간 조정부;를 포함하는 실시간성 우선 콘텐츠 데이터 전송 장치
|
12 |
12
제10항에 있어서,상기 가상 슬롯 정보 결정부는상기 우선 콘텐츠 데이터에 대한 코덱 정보 및 상기 우선 콘텐츠 데이터의 서비스 품질(QoS)에 대한 상기 기준 수준을 고려하여 상기 우선 콘텐츠 데이터에 대한 데이터 전송 지연변이의 허용 범위를 결정하는 실시간성 우선 콘텐츠 데이터 전송 장치
|
13 |
13
우선 콘텐츠 데이터를 전송하지 않는 단말에 포함되는, 실시간성 우선 콘텐츠 데이터의 품질 보장 장치에 있어서,우선 콘텐츠 데이터의 서비스 품질(QoS)을 기준 수준 이상으로 보장할 수 있도록 상기 우선 콘텐츠 데이터를 위하여 할당될 가상 슬롯에 대하여 결정된 길이와 주기 정보를 포함하는, 상기 가상 슬롯에 대한 할당요청 메시지를 네트워크로부터 수신하는 메시지 수신부; 및상기 가상 슬롯에 대한 길이와 주기 정보에 기초하여 도출되는, 상기 가상 슬롯에 대하여 할당된 시간 구간 이외의 시간 구간에 상기 네트워크 상에 우선 콘텐츠 데이터를 전송하지 않는 단말 자신의 전송 슬롯에서 보낼 데이터를 전송하는 데이터 전송부;를 포함하는 실시간성 우선 콘텐츠 데이터의 품질 보장 장치
|
14 |
14
제13항에 있어서,상기 메시지 수신부는상기 가상 슬롯에 대한 할당요청 메시지로부터 상기 우선 콘텐츠 데이터에 대한 데이터 전송 지연변이의 허용 범위 정보를 추출하고,상기 데이터 전송부는,상기 단말 자신의 전송 슬롯에서 보낼 데이터의 전송이 종료되는 시간이 상기 가상 슬롯에 대하여 할당된 시작 시간으로부터 상기 데이터 전송 지연변이의 허용 범위 이내이면 상기 단말 자신의 전송 슬롯에서 보낼 데이터를 상기 네트워크 상에 전송하는 실시간성 우선 콘텐츠 데이터의 품질 보장 장치
|